Mesnac Co., Ltd. (SHE:002073)
China flag China · Delayed Price · Currency is CNY
8.02
-0.17 (-2.08%)
At close: Feb 13, 2026

Mesnac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
8,1788,4216,6495,9627,5144,371
Market Cap Growth
-6.72%26.63%11.52%-20.65%71.91%0.43%
Enterprise Value
5,7576,5495,8445,0376,4933,302
Last Close Price
8.028.116.365.917.574.50
PE Ratio
17.5516.6419.9629.4252.8245.96
Forward PE
-34.0934.0934.0934.0934.09
PS Ratio
1.031.171.181.041.381.42
PB Ratio
1.261.351.201.171.590.97
P/TBV Ratio
1.421.521.361.341.821.12
P/FCF Ratio
15.0813.61---137.84
P/OCF Ratio
9.869.1928.7415.5829.7525.34
EV/Sales Ratio
0.720.911.030.881.191.07
EV/EBITDA Ratio
7.157.809.1412.4421.1613.40
EV/EBIT Ratio
10.7111.2514.7622.3140.0528.45
EV/FCF Ratio
10.6110.59---104.11
Debt / Equity Ratio
0.300.260.320.290.230.09
Debt / EBITDA Ratio
2.411.962.783.663.471.71
Debt / FCF Ratio
3.572.66---13.26
Net Debt / Equity Ratio
-0.43-0.49-0.34-0.32-0.27-0.31
Net Debt / EBITDA Ratio
-3.46-3.69-2.94-4.01-4.11-5.63
Net Debt / FCF Ratio
-5.14-5.016.3922.843.18-43.74
Asset Turnover
0.420.420.380.470.570.38
Inventory Turnover
0.840.890.831.141.651.38
Quick Ratio
0.550.630.630.670.800.95
Current Ratio
1.261.311.271.331.591.68
Return on Equity (ROE)
8.30%9.75%7.43%4.74%2.74%1.63%
Return on Assets (ROA)
1.78%2.10%1.67%1.15%1.06%0.90%
Return on Invested Capital (ROIC)
13.35%15.55%10.68%6.52%4.44%2.57%
Return on Capital Employed (ROCE)
7.10%7.70%6.00%3.60%2.80%2.50%
Earnings Yield
5.70%6.01%5.01%3.40%1.89%2.18%
FCF Yield
6.63%7.35%-4.43%-1.19%-5.28%0.73%
Dividend Yield
1.25%1.23%1.57%0.78%--
Payout Ratio
45.22%31.56%31.99%29.28%23.13%-
Buyback Yield / Dilution
-3.12%-6.14%-1.25%-2.25%0.32%0.80%
Total Shareholder Return
-1.90%-4.91%0.32%-1.47%0.32%0.80%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.